Multiplicative Inverse of 8700

Multiplicative Inverse of 8700 is defined as what you can multiply with 8700 to get 1.
If the Multiplicative Inverse of 8700 is x, the problem can be written as a function as follows:
8700(x) = 1
Thus, to get the answer, we divide 1 by 8700 like this:
1 / 8700 = 0.00011494
Note that the answer is rounded to the nearest 8 decimals if necessary. We can prove that the answer is correct: 0.00011494 multiplied by 8700 equals 1.
The Multiplicative Inverse of postive 8700 has a positive answer and the Multiplicative Inverse of negative 8700 has a negative answer. Therefore, the Multiplicative Inverse of -8700 is -0.00011494.
